What does case status " Awaiting summons " means ?
03-Dec-2023 (In Criminal Law)
The case status of “awaiting summons” typically means that the court has accepted a petition or a complaint, and is yet to issue a summons to the respondent (the person against whom the complaint or petition is filed).
Once a petition or a complaint is filed in a court, the court examines it to determine whether it satisfies the legal requirements and is admissible. If the court is satisfied that the petition or complaint is admissible, it may issue a summons to the respondent to appear in court on a specified date.
In India, a summons is usually issued by a court under Section 27 of the Code of Civil Procedure (CPC), 1908 or Section 204 of the Criminal Procedure Code (CrPC), 1973. The summons contains the details of the case, the date of the hearing, and the instructions for the respondent to appear in court.
